Low Carb Vodka Cosmopolitan

Indulge in the tangy sophistication of a Low Carb Vodka Cosmopolitan, the ultimate guilt-free cocktail for your happy hour lineup! This sleek, keto-friendly twist on the classic vodka cosmo swaps out sugary mixers for a blend of freshly squeezed lime juice, sugar-free cranberry drink mix, and a hint of sugar-free orange extract. The result is a perfectly balanced, refreshing drink that's big on flavor and low on carbs! Ready in just five minutes, this effortless cocktail is shaken with ice for a crisp chill and beautifully garnished with a lime wheel for an elegant finishing touch. Sip, relax, and enjoy this low-carb cocktail gem—ideal for entertaining or treating yourself.

Prep Time:5 mins
Cook Time:0 mins
Total Time:5 mins
Servings: 1

Ingredients

  • 2 oz Vodka
  • 1 oz Lime Juice (freshly squeezed)
  • 0.5 tsp Sugar-Free Cranberry Drink Mix
  • 0.25 tsp Sugar-Free Orange Extract
  • 1 cup Ice Cubes
  • 1 piece Lime Wheel (for garnish)

Directions

Step 1

Fill a cocktail shaker with the ice cubes.

Step 2

Add vodka, lime juice, sugar-free cranberry drink mix, and sugar-free orange extract to the shaker.

Step 3

Secure the lid on the shaker and shake vigorously for 15-20 seconds until the mixture is well chilled.

Step 4

Strain the cocktail into a chilled martini or coupe glass.

Step 5

Garnish with a lime wheel on the rim or floating in the glass.

Step 6

Serve immediately and enjoy!
